On average across the year,
yes, Turkmenistan is hotter than
Shoreline, Washington
.
Turkmenistan has an average temperature of 17°C/63°F and Shoreline, Washington has an average temperature of 12°C/54°F.
Turkmenistan's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 39°C/102°F, which is hotter than Shoreline, Washington's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 26°C/79°F).
On average across the year, no, Turkmenistan is not colder than Shoreline, Washington . Turkmenistan has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F and Shoreline, Washington has an average minimum temperature of 8°C/46°F.
On average across the year,
no, Turkmenistan has less rain than
Shoreline, Washington. Turkmenistan has an average annual rainfall of 89mm and Shoreline, Washington has an average annual rainfall of 1094mm.
Turkmenistan's wettest month is March, with an average monthly rainfall of 18mm, which is drier than Shoreline, Washington's wettest month (November, with an average monthly rainfall of 166mm).
